{"id":4749,"date":"2015-01-14T10:19:43","date_gmt":"2015-01-14T09:19:43","guid":{"rendered":"https:\/\/www.combell.com\/fr\/blog\/?p=4749"},"modified":"2019-04-15T09:48:21","modified_gmt":"2019-04-15T07:48:21","slug":"php-5-6-est-desormais-disponible-avec-lhebergement-mutualise-linux","status":"publish","type":"post","link":"https:\/\/www.combell.com\/fr\/blog\/php-5-6-est-desormais-disponible-avec-lhebergement-mutualise-linux\/","title":{"rendered":"PHP 5.6 est d\u00e9sormais disponible avec l\u2019h\u00e9bergement mutualis\u00e9 Linux"},"content":{"rendered":"<p>\u00c0 partir d\u2019aujourd\u2019hui, nous proposons la version 5.6 de PHP sur notre environnement d\u2019<a title=\"Linux hosting\" href=\"https:\/\/www.combell.com\/fr\/hebergement\/hebergement-web\" target=\"_blank\" rel=\"noopener noreferrer\">h\u00e9bergement mutualis\u00e9 Linux<\/a>. Cette nouvelle version de PHP est \u00e9galement la derni\u00e8re version majeure qui tombera sous le nom de PHP 5.<\/p>\n<p>Comme toujours, l\u2019\u00e9quipe de d\u00e9veloppement de PHP a pr\u00e9vu un <a title=\"Passer \u00e0 PHP 5.6\" href=\"http:\/\/php.net\/manual\/en\/migration56.php\" target=\"_blank\" rel=\"noopener noreferrer\">pratique aper\u00e7u<\/a> qui explique les choses dont vous devez tenir compte si vous voulez passer \u00e0 la version 5.6. L\u2019aper\u00e7u comprend des modifications entra\u00eenant une incompatibilit\u00e9 ascendante, des nouvelles fonctionnalit\u00e9s, des fonctionnalit\u00e9s obsol\u00e8tes, ainsi que des fonctions existantes qui ont \u00e9t\u00e9 modifi\u00e9es.<\/p>\n<p>Les principales <a title=\"Nouveaut\u00e9s PHP 5.6\" href=\"http:\/\/php.net\/manual\/en\/migration56.new-features.php\" target=\"_blank\" rel=\"noopener noreferrer\">nouveaut\u00e9s<\/a> sont entres autres :<\/p>\n<ul>\n<li><strong>Expressions constantes<\/strong> : autrefois, vous ne pouviez associer que des valeurs scalaires litt\u00e9rales \u00e0 une constante. D\u00e9sormais, vous pouvez \u00e9galement utiliser des expressions interpr\u00e9t\u00e9es avec des valeurs num\u00e9riques et textuelles.<\/li>\n<li><strong><a title=\"Fonctions variadiques\" href=\"http:\/\/php.net\/manual\/en\/functions.arguments.php#functions.variable-arg-list\" target=\"_blank\" rel=\"noopener noreferrer\"><strong>Fonctions variadiques<\/strong><\/a><\/strong> : la possibilit\u00e9 de traiter un nombre variable d\u2019arguments de fonctions de mani\u00e8re \u00e9l\u00e9gante.<\/li>\n<li><strong>D\u00e9compression des arguments<\/strong> : la possibilit\u00e9 de d\u00e9compresser et de communiquer des arguments de fonctions en tant que tableaux.<\/li>\n<li><strong>Exponentiation<\/strong> : la possibilit\u00e9 d\u2019\u00e9lever des nombres \u00e0 une certaine puissance au moyen d\u2019un op\u00e9rateur au lieu d\u2019une fonction.<\/li>\n<li><strong><a title=\"Importations d\u2019espaces\" href=\"http:\/\/php.net\/manual\/en\/language.namespaces.importing.php\" target=\"_blank\" rel=\"noopener noreferrer\">Importations d\u2019espaces<\/a><\/strong> <strong>de noms de fonctions et de constantes<\/strong> : jusqu\u2019\u00e0 il y a peu, vous ne pouviez effectuer des importations d\u2019espaces de noms que de classes. \u00c0 partir de la version 5.6, cela pourra aussi se faire pour les fonctions et les constantes.<\/li>\n<li><strong>La m\u00e9thode magique <a title=\"__debugInfo()\" href=\"http:\/\/php.net\/manual\/en\/language.oop5.magic.php#language.oop5.magic.debuginfo\" target=\"_blank\" rel=\"noopener noreferrer\">__debugInfo()<\/a><\/strong> : la m\u00e9thode magique __debugInfo() vous permet de modifier le comportement d\u2019un var_dump pour une classe.<\/li>\n<\/ul>\n<p><!--more--><\/p>\n<p>Il y a en outre quelques <a title=\"Backward incompatible changes\" href=\"http:\/\/php.net\/manual\/en\/migration56.incompatible.php\" target=\"_blank\" rel=\"noopener noreferrer\">modifications entra\u00eenant une incompatibilit\u00e9 ascendante<\/a>, c\u2019est-\u00e0-dire des modifications sp\u00e9cifiques qui font qu\u2019un certain comportement en PHP n\u2019est plus compatible. G\u00e9n\u00e9ralement, il s\u2019agit de fonctionnalit\u00e9s qui \u00e9taient consid\u00e9r\u00e9es comme obsol\u00e8tes dans les versions pr\u00e9c\u00e9dentes.<\/p>\n<p>Ensuite, il y a certaines fonctionnalit\u00e9s qui sont consid\u00e9r\u00e9es comme \u00e9tant <a title=\"Deprecated features\" href=\"http:\/\/php.net\/manual\/en\/migration56.deprecated.php\" target=\"_blank\" rel=\"noopener noreferrer\">obsol\u00e8tes<\/a> dans PHP 5.6 et qui dispara\u00eetront dans les versions futures. Vous en retrouverez la liste dans le m\u00eame aper\u00e7u.<\/p>\n<p>Et comme d\u2019habitude, nous constatons que chaque nouvelle version de PHP est plus rapide et plus s\u00fbre que les pr\u00e9c\u00e9dentes. Bien que nous proposions d\u00e9sormais PHP 5.6 sur notre h\u00e9bergement mutualis\u00e9 Linux, la version standard pour les nouveaux packs reste toujours la version 5.5. Via votre panneau de contr\u00f4le, vous pouvez effectuer une mise \u00e0 niveau vers la version 5.6 en un seul clic.<\/p>\n<p><strong>Que r\u00e9serve l\u2019avenir ?<\/strong><\/p>\n<p>Comme nous l\u2019avons mentionn\u00e9, PHP 5.6 est la derni\u00e8re version majeure de PHP 5. On s\u2019attendrait \u00e0 ce que ce soit la version PHP 6 qui suive, <a title=\"La version PHP suivante\" href=\"https:\/\/wiki.php.net\/rfc\/php6\" target=\"_blank\" rel=\"noopener noreferrer\">mais ce ne sera pas le cas<\/a>. La version 6 sera en effet \u00ab saut\u00e9e \u00bb pour passer directement \u00e0 la <a title=\"PHP 7\" href=\"https:\/\/wiki.php.net\/rfc\/php7timeline\" target=\"_blank\" rel=\"noopener noreferrer\">version 7<\/a>, qui devrait en principe \u00eatre lanc\u00e9e fin 2015.<\/p>\n<p>Nous sommes en tout cas tr\u00e8s impatients de tester cette nouvelle version, mais en attendant, nous vous conseillons vivement d\u2019essayer PHP 5.6.<\/p>\n<p><strong>Conclusion<\/strong><\/p>\n<p>La derni\u00e8re version de PHP 5 sera propos\u00e9e en option durant quelques mois via <a title=\"My Combell\" href=\"https:\/\/my.combell.com\/fr\/login\" target=\"_blank\" rel=\"noopener noreferrer\">my.combell.com<\/a>. Ensuite, nous l\u2019adopterons en tant que version standard une fois que les versions mineures seront disponibles.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>\u00c0 partir d\u2019aujourd\u2019hui, nous proposons la version 5.6 de PHP sur notre environnement d\u2019h\u00e9bergement mutualis\u00e9 Linux. Cette nouvelle version de PHP est \u00e9galement la derni\u00e8re version majeure qui tombera sous...<\/p>\n","protected":false},"author":5,"featured_media":5310,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_uag_custom_page_level_css":"","footnotes":""},"categories":[67,68,62,64,76,73],"tags":[],"acf":[],"uagb_featured_image_src":{"full":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56.jpg",850,290,false],"thumbnail":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56-50x50.jpg",50,50,true],"medium":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56-300x102.jpg",300,102,true],"medium_large":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56.jpg",768,262,false],"large":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56.jpg",850,290,false],"1536x1536":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56.jpg",850,290,false],"2048x2048":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56.jpg",850,290,false],"post-featured":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56.jpg",850,290,false],"post-featured-opt":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56.jpg",750,256,false],"post-featured-opt-md":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56.jpg",850,290,false],"post-featured-opt-sm":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56.jpg",485,165,false],"post-featured-opt-xs":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56.jpg",375,128,false],"post-most-popular":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56-50x50.jpg",50,50,true],"post-author":["https:\/\/www.combell.com\/fr\/blog\/files\/2015\/01\/php56-60x60.jpg",60,60,true]},"uagb_author_info":{"display_name":"Romy","author_link":"https:\/\/www.combell.com\/fr\/blog\/author\/romy\/"},"uagb_comment_info":0,"uagb_excerpt":"\u00c0 partir d\u2019aujourd\u2019hui, nous proposons la version 5.6 de PHP sur notre environnement d\u2019h\u00e9bergement mutualis\u00e9 Linux. Cette nouvelle version de PHP est \u00e9galement la derni\u00e8re version majeure qui tombera sous...","_links":{"self":[{"href":"https:\/\/www.combell.com\/fr\/blog\/wp-json\/wp\/v2\/posts\/4749"}],"collection":[{"href":"https:\/\/www.combell.com\/fr\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.combell.com\/fr\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.combell.com\/fr\/blog\/wp-json\/wp\/v2\/users\/5"}],"replies":[{"embeddable":true,"href":"https:\/\/www.combell.com\/fr\/blog\/wp-json\/wp\/v2\/comments?post=4749"}],"version-history":[{"count":5,"href":"https:\/\/www.combell.com\/fr\/blog\/wp-json\/wp\/v2\/posts\/4749\/revisions"}],"predecessor-version":[{"id":7142,"href":"https:\/\/www.combell.com\/fr\/blog\/wp-json\/wp\/v2\/posts\/4749\/revisions\/7142"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.combell.com\/fr\/blog\/wp-json\/wp\/v2\/media\/5310"}],"wp:attachment":[{"href":"https:\/\/www.combell.com\/fr\/blog\/wp-json\/wp\/v2\/media?parent=4749"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.combell.com\/fr\/blog\/wp-json\/wp\/v2\/categories?post=4749"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.combell.com\/fr\/blog\/wp-json\/wp\/v2\/tags?post=4749"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}